Commit Graph

8954 Commits

Author SHA1 Message Date
Alexander Bock f390051e1d Update submodules. Disable /ZI compile-flag when Tracy is enabled to prevent compile errors 2021-11-04 11:35:09 +01:00
Alexander Bock 0c295ef15d Fix compile error introduced with previous commit 2021-11-02 15:11:34 +01:00
Alexander Bock fb6807b1e0 Add the ability for lua libraries to define sublibraries 2021-11-01 22:44:32 +01:00
eriksunden 24ce66aad4 Feature/tileinterpolation (#1769)
* Interpolation of tiles added to tileprovider, with additional new shaders to make this work.
 * Asset file for testing interpolation

Co-authored-by: tobiasp93 <tobias.pettersson@liu.se>
Co-authored-by: Alexander Bock <alexander.bock@liu.se>
2021-11-01 09:24:40 +01:00
Malin E 31b908952c Merge pull request #1759 from OpenSpace/feature/animation-fixes
JWST update
2021-10-25 13:50:40 +02:00
Malin E c94ce3c78a Move reparent script 2021-10-25 11:05:31 +02:00
Malin E a8c74979c1 Merge branch 'master' into feature/animation-fixes 2021-10-25 10:51:13 +02:00
Malin E d86923ebb7 Fix ScriptScheduler tests 2021-10-25 10:49:24 +02:00
Micah 28b9862b7c fix for url sync override dictionary value 2021-10-21 12:02:49 -04:00
Malin E d23f220fd2 Add function to destroy the current state machine 2021-10-21 11:16:59 +02:00
GPayne c887b1fa80 Merge branch 'master' of https://github.com/OpenSpace/OpenSpace 2021-10-15 14:57:06 -06:00
GPayne 4211691c7f Update ghoul version for lua variant fix on linux 2021-10-15 14:56:31 -06:00
Gene Payne f5ed0eae0c Typo fix in eventEngine for non-windows builds 2021-10-15 14:22:08 -06:00
ElonOlsson a1517164f0 Merge pull request #1655 from OpenSpace/thesis/2020/radiation
Thesis/2020/radiation
2021-10-15 14:45:31 -04:00
ElonOlsson d7f9c1a124 merge with master 2021-10-14 11:07:01 -04:00
ElonOlsson d0dfa67641 removed a space 2021-10-14 11:01:50 -04:00
Malin E fc4c3f1cfa Merge branch 'master' into feature/animation-fixes
* Resolve conflicts in scene.cpp
2021-10-14 14:23:24 +02:00
Alexander Bock 4a860fb01d Some code facelifting 2021-10-14 10:31:46 +02:00
Alexander Bock 8d26f6e167 Set the user-agent when requesting a download (closes #1765). Also report the error code if a download fails 2021-10-13 21:46:08 +02:00
ElonOlsson 7905c7acc2 quick bug fix 2021-10-13 14:18:53 -04:00
Emma Broman f38a7242e7 Fix the globetransformatons fix in previous commit (bc306c6f1b)
It broke the TimelineTranslation for when keyframes were using GlobeTranslations. The intial position was not set up correctly for these when the code for finding the globe was done in the update.

Bringing back the check in the matrix/position methods solved the problem. Probably the globe is guaranteed to be created when reaching this function
2021-10-12 13:25:24 +02:00
Malin E 1f0b44959f Clean up TimelineTranslation position calculation 2021-10-12 08:58:18 +02:00
Malin E 659cc09e4b Address PR comments 2021-10-12 08:52:03 +02:00
Emma Broman bc306c6f1b Fix globe transformations not updating from height map if simulation time paused (#1766) 2021-10-12 08:37:25 +02:00
Alexander Bock 76dd45e5ce Event System (#1741)
* Add implementation of the EventEngine to handle global event chains
* Add properties to SceneGraphNodes to determine two distance radii for camera-based events
2021-10-11 21:53:00 +02:00
Emma Broman d230675181 Add Lua function to get current application time 2021-10-11 15:43:06 +02:00
Malin E 8992f983c6 Address PR comments 2021-10-11 14:00:19 +02:00
Alexander Bock 7c7e5b2999 Remove some warnings 2021-10-11 13:38:00 +02:00
Emma Broman aa2c94fa4c Support negative altitudes in GlobeTranslation
Necessary when height map is not used and a large negative offset is needed
2021-10-11 13:31:14 +02:00
Malin E 5152258c9a Add property to run or not run scripts at a time jump in
scriptsScheduler
2021-10-11 10:39:57 +02:00
Malin E 630360cfad Fix broken backward scripts in scriptScheduler 2021-10-11 10:29:20 +02:00
Gene Payne e78be1e4bc Merge pull request #1760 from OpenSpace/issue/1757
Fixes Problem with Profile Properties Not Handling Table Entries (Issue 1757)
2021-10-08 14:52:48 -06:00
Malin E e2c592e049 WIP: Add groups to scriptScheduler
* NOTE: This breaks the backwards scripts
2021-10-08 19:17:06 +02:00
Malin E 48597ec222 Merge branch 'master' into feature/animation-fixes 2021-10-08 16:22:18 +02:00
Malin E db4f4e18ac Add action to toggle jwst trails 2021-10-08 16:20:54 +02:00
Malin E 983f7c2838 Fix forward JWST play script timing 2021-10-08 14:32:20 +02:00
GPayne a2a8f93ba5 Moved string bracket trim function to ghoul library 2021-10-07 16:10:00 -06:00
Malin E 1a4ded3b3b Add action to switch forward/backward direction of timelapse 2021-10-07 13:44:41 +02:00
Malin E 826697360d Add dashboard text with time speed information 2021-10-07 11:55:02 +02:00
GPayne c36ea36a43 Code review changes 2021-10-07 00:26:29 -06:00
GPayne 990835d7cd Fix for crash if profile has no camera entry 2021-10-06 16:05:07 -06:00
GPayne 515bdd6b1f Fix for profile relative time errors 2021-10-06 15:47:10 -06:00
Malin E 992778bd50 Make JWSTPosition to a TimelineTranslation
* Switches from being parented to Earth to being parented to L2 at 2018
  NOV 01 00:00:00

* JWSTPosition depends on two horizons files that have different
  observers (Earth and L2)
2021-10-06 18:00:10 +02:00
Malin E 26101b66cc Add action to play timelapse in reverse 2021-10-06 13:05:14 +02:00
ElonOlsson 03371c6cdb Merge branch 'master' into thesis/2020/radiation 2021-10-05 14:52:38 -04:00
ElonOlsson 60e2abdbb8 bastille day 2000 renaming 2021-10-05 10:22:55 -04:00
Malin E 19e936ea18 Fix JWST keybindings 2021-10-04 11:17:12 +02:00
Malin E be263ca436 Decrease size of JWST label 2021-10-04 11:08:36 +02:00
Malin E 102139176b Split trail into two, one with Earth as parent and one with L2 2021-10-04 11:02:41 +02:00
Emma Broman 821e746c1a Fix RenderablePlaneImageOnline not updating size on property change 2021-10-04 10:23:11 +02:00